Thatcher by Patrick Walsh-Atkins

An exam-focused study of the three main issues about Thatcher, designed specifically for todays AS and A Level students.

Patrick Walsh-Atkins is Deputy Headteacher, Bromsgrove School, Chief Examiner for A level Government and Poitics, and Reviser for A2 History.

Derrick Murphy, the Series Editor, is Deputy Principal, St Dominic’s VIth Form College, Harrow, and a Principal Examiner for OCR
